CLIMB Fund, a certified Community Development Financial Institution (CDFI), is dedicated to supporting small and micro businesses through accessible financing. By leveraging the South Carolina Community Development Tax Credits, CLIMB Fund has expanded its lending capacity, helping entrepreneurs achieve their dreams—just like Cassandra Gamble.
For three years, Cassandra successfully managed Blush Bridal & Formal Wear, turning around the boutique’s profitability after it struggled under previous ownership. With a CLIMB Fund loan, she was able to take the next step in her 15-year career in the fashion and bridal industry—purchasing the boutique and becoming its 100% owner. Now, as a proud business owner, Cassandra has ambitious plans for growth, including hiring four employees within the next two years.
